  • Medications for Colonic Neoplasms

    FiltersReset Filters
    8 results
    • capecitabine

      (capecitabine)
      BluePoint Laboratories
      Usage: Capecitabine is indicated for the treatment of various cancers, including Stage III colon cancer, locally advanced rectal cancer, unresectable or metastatic colorectal cancer, advanced or metastatic breast cancer, and unresectable or metastatic gastric and pancreatic cancers, often in combination with other chemotherapy agents.
    • capecitabine

      (Capecitabine)
      Aurobindo Pharma Limited
      Usage: Capecitabine tablets are indicated for the treatment of Stage III colon cancer, locally advanced rectal cancer, unresectable or metastatic colorectal cancer, advanced or metastatic breast cancer, unresectable gastric or esophageal cancers, and as adjuvant therapy for pancreatic adenocarcinoma in combination with chemotherapy regimens.
    • fluorouracil

      (FLUOROURACIL)
      Eugia US LLC
      Usage: Fluorouracil injection is indicated for treating patients with adenocarcinoma of the colon and rectum, breast, stomach, and pancreas.
    • irinotecan hydrochloride

      (Irinotecan Hydrochloride)
      Hikma Pharmaceuticals USA Inc.
      Usage: Irinotecan Hydrochloride Injection is indicated for patients with metastatic colon or rectal carcinoma that has recurred or progressed after initial treatment with fluorouracil-based therapy.
    • oxaliplatin

      (Oxaliplatin)
      Sandoz Inc
      Usage: Oxaliplatin injection, combined with infusional fluorouracil and leucovorin, is indicated for the adjuvant treatment of stage III colon cancer post-complete tumor resection and for the treatment of advanced colorectal cancer.
